Dookie

GreenDayDookie.jpg
Dookie is an album by the rock band Green Day. Released on February 1, 1994 (see 1994 in music), Dookie became a sensation among the American mainstream, caused considerable controversy in the punk rock community, with many critics claiming the band had sold out. With singles like "When I Come Around", "Basket Case" and "Longview" all going to #1 on Billboards Modern Rock Tracks chart, Dookie was propelled to the #1 spot Billboard's Heatseekers and #1 on the Billboard 200 album charts.

Dookie won a Grammy Award for Best Alternative Music Album[?].

Charting singles

 1994	Basket Case	        Mainstream Rock Tracks	                No. 9
 1994	Longview	        Mainstream Rock Tracks	                No. 13
 1994	Basket Case	        Modern Rock Tracks	                No. 1
 1994	Longview	        Modern Rock Tracks	                No. 1
 1994	Welcome To Paradise	Modern Rock Tracks	                No. 7
 1994	Basket Case	        Top 40 Mainstream	                No. 16
 1995	She	                Mainstream Rock Tracks	                No. 18
 1995	When I Come Around	Mainstream Rock Tracks	                No. 2
 1995	She	                Modern Rock Tracks	                No. 5
 1995	When I Come Around	Modern Rock Tracks	                No. 1
 1995	When I Come Around	Top 40 Mainstream	                No. 2
